/* ------------------------------------ *
 CSS arei.it
 luned́ 30 gennaio 2006 22.33.45
 HAPedit 3.1.11.111
 * ------------------------------------ */
body {
     top: 10px;
     margin-top: 10px;
     font-size: 10pt;
     background-image: url("../grafics/bg_arei.gif");
     background-repeat: repeat;
     background-position: left bottom;
     font-family: Tahoma, Helvetica, Sans-Serif, "MS Arial";
     }

table{ border: 0px none;}
td{ border: 0px none;}
tr{ border: 0px none;}
h1,h2,h3,h4,h5,h6 {
                  font-family: Helvetica, Tahoma, Sans-Serif, "MS Arial";
                  color:#000060;
                  font-weight:400;
                  }
td.menu, td.menu:visited, td.menu:link  {
         background-image: url("../grafics/sfondo.png");
         background-repeat: repeat-x;
         background-position: center;
         height: 27px;
         text-align: center;
         border-bottom:2px solid #C80300;
         border-left:1px solid #C80300;
		}
td.menu:hover  {
         background-image: url("../grafics/sfondo_over.png");
         background-repeat: repeat-x;
         background-position: center;
         height: 27px;
         text-align: center;   
         border-bottom:2px solid #C80300;
         border-left:1px solid #C80300;         
         }
a.menu, a.menu:visited, a.menu:link
          {display:block;
           font-family: "Comic Sans Ms", Helvetica, Tahoma, Sans-Serif;
           font-size: 11pt;
           font-weight: 700;
           font-style: normal;
           text-decoration: none;
           letter-spacing: 1px;
           color: #e02c00; }
a.menu:hover
		{ display:block;
          font-size: 11pt;
          font-weight: 700;
          font-style: normal;
          text-decoration: none;
          letter-spacing: 1px;
          color: #FFE232; } 
          
td.menu_s, td.menu_s:visited, td.menu_s:link, td.menu_s:hover {
         background-image: url("../grafics/sfondo_over.png");
         background-repeat: repeat-x;
         background-position: center;
         height: 27px;
         text-align: center;
         border-bottom:2px solid #C80300;
         border-left:1px solid #C80300;
         }
a.menu_s, a.menu_s:visited, a.menu_s:link
          {display:block;
           font-family: "Comic Sans Ms", Helvetica, Tahoma, Sans-Serif;
           font-size: 11pt;
           font-weight: 700;
           font-style: normal;
           text-decoration: none;
           letter-spacing: 1px;
           color: #ffff00; }
a.menu_s:hover
         {display:block;
          font-family: "Comic Sans Ms", Helvetica, Tahoma, Sans-Serif;
          font-size: 11pt;
          font-weight: 700;
          font-style: normal;
          text-decoration: none;
          letter-spacing: 1px;
          color: #ffbb00; }         
table.page_main {
      text-align: left;
      background-color: #ffffff;
      }
/*
da tenere sempre
*/
h5.db_titolo, h5.db_sovra, h5.db_testo, h5.db_titolo_banner, h5.db_sovra_banner, h5.db_testo_banner
   {
   margin-top: 2px;
   margin-bottom: 2px;
   margin-left: 8px;
   margin-right: 8px;
   }

h5.testo_red {
              font-weight: 700;
              color: #f00000;
              text-align: center;
              }
h5.alert {font-weight: 400;
          color: #f00000;
          font-size:10pt;
          text-align: center;
          }
h5.id {font-size: 10pt;
       font-weight: 400;
       color: #0000B0;
       margin-left:4px;
       margin-right:4px;
       }
h6.db_id
      {font-family: Tahoma, Verdana, Arial, San-Serif;
       font-size: 9px;
       font-weight: 400;
       font-style: normal;
       color: #505050;
       text-align: left;
       }
/* menu di sinistra left */
h6.left {
        font-family: Tahoma, Verdana, Arial, San-Serif;
        font-size: 10pt;
        font-weight: 700;
        margin-left: 4px;
        margin-right:4px;
        letter-spacing: 0px;
        color: #0000f0;
        }
img.pos {
        vertical-align: bottom;
        margin-left: 8px;
        margin-right: 8px;
        margin-top: 4px;
        margin-bottom: 4px;
        border: 0px none;
        }
img {
    text-decoration: none;
    border: 0px none;
    }
p {
   margin:2px;
  }
p.top   {
        text-align: center;
        }
p.bottom {
        text-align: center;
        }
p.top_left   {
        float: left;
        margin-top: 4px;
        margin-bottom: 4px;
        }
p.top_right {
        float: right;
        margin-top: 4px;
        margin-bottom: 4px;
        }
p.bottom_left   {
        float: left;
        margin-top: 4px;
        margin-top: 4px;
        vertical-align: bottom;
        }
p.bottom_right {
        float: right;
        margin-top: 4px;
        margin-top: 4px;
        vertical-align: bottom;
        }
a, a:visited {
    text-decoration: underline;
    color: #ff4400;
}
a:hover {
    text-decoration: underline;
    color: #ff1000;
}
a.left, a.left:visited {
    font-size: 10pt;
    margin-top:4px;
    margin-bottom:4px;
    text-decoration: none;
    color: #ff3300;
}
a.left:hover {
    font-size: 10pt;
    margin-top:4px;
    margin-bottom:4px;
    text-decoration: underline;
    color: #ff3300;
}
a.img, a.img:visited {
    text-decoration: none;
    border: 0px none;
}
a.img:hover {
    text-decoration: none;
    border: 0px none;
}
a.banner, a.banner:visited {
    text-decoration: none;
    color : #0000f0;
}
a.banner:hover {
    text-decoration: underline;
    color: #ff4400;
}
a.db_a, a.db_a:visited {
    text-decoration: none;
    color: #ff4400;
    font-weight: 700;
}
a.db_a:hover {
    text-decoration: underline;
    font-weight: 700;
    color: #ff4400;
}
/*
fine standard
*/
h6.sotto{
           font-family: "Comic Sans Ms", Helvetica, Tahoma, Sans-Serif;
           font-size: 14px;
           font-weight:400;
           font-style: normal;
           margin-top: 0px;
           margin-bottom: 0px;
           margin-left: 4px;
           margin-right: 4px;
           text-decoration: none;
           color: #FFFFFF;}
a.footer, a.footer:visited  {
           font-family: "Comic Sans Ms", Helvetica, Tahoma, Sans-Serif;
           font-size: 12px;
           text-decoration: none;
           letter-spacing: 2px;
           color: #FFFFD4;
          }

a.footer:hover {
          font-family: "Comic Sans Ms","Trebuchet MS", Tahoma, Arial, Sans-Serif;
          font-size: 12px;
          text-decoration: underline;
          letter-spacing: 2px;
          color: #ff4400;
          }

input.in_princ {
     height: 26px;
     margin-left: 10px;
     margin-right: 10px;
     margin-top: 10px;
     color: #000080;
     font-family: Tahoma;
     font-size: 12px;
     font-style: normal;
     font-weight: 700;
     }
input.in_princ:hover {
     height: 26px;
     margin-left: 10px;
     margin-right: 10px;
     margin-top: 10px;
     font-family: Tahoma;
     font-size: 12px;
     font-style: normal;
     font-weight: 700;
     color: #ff0000;
     }


